Position Summary:

Operate and maintain spray drying equipment in pharmaceutical products manufacturing facility. Pay is $20 - $22 per hour depending on experience plus $1.50 differential pay for 2nd and 3rd shifts.

Essential Functions:




  • Understand raw material blending and finished goods packaging functions



  • Be familiar with inventory control procedures and production batch records



  • Be familiar with manufacturing equipment to assure equipment is in good working order



  • Operate the equipment (spray dryer) using the proper cores and orifices and make sure they are cleaned or replaced when necessary



  • Check spray patterns and make corrections when necessary



  • Record equipment readings and product moisture noting any discrepancies



  • Record any problems or peculiarities in the finished product



  • Determine special packaging requirements



  • Sample finished product and test for proper moisture content, color and consistency



  • Make certain the blender always has an adequate amount of product available for drying



  • Oversee the cleaning of the equipment and surrounding areas



  • Responsible for self-involvement, team involvement and execution of tasks relative to achieving annual departmental goals




Requirements:




  • High School Diploma or equivalent, preferred and 1 to 2 years of experience in a manufacturing environment (preferably in the pharmaceutical field)



  • Must have high school level reading, math and comprehension skills




Working Conditions:




  • Position may require walking/standing for long periods; reaching above shoulder heights, below the waist or lifting



  • Frequent relocating of 100-200 lb. fiber barrels and 55 lb. bags required



  • Exposure to powder and heavy equipment in a loud manufacturing atmosphere



  • Manufacturing environment with exposure to powder mineral products, cleaning chemicals, restricted movement, dirty environment, hazardous materials, lifting and carrying heavy objects



  • In accordance with the OSHA Respiratory Protection Standard (29CFR 1910.134) Balchem employees (Production, Quality, R&D, and Maintenance) are required to successfully complete annual fit testing (clean shaven req.) and medical clearance (respirator medical certification)



  • In addition, when required to wear a respirator, wearers must wear it as they fit tested (clean shaven)
